San Vicente is a fifth class municipality in the province of Camarines Norte, Philippines. According to the 2015 census, it has a population of 10,396 people.
San Vicente is politically subdivided into 9 barangays.
In the 2015 census, the population of San Vicente, Camarines Norte, was 10,396 people, with a density of 180 inhabitants per square kilometre or 470 inhabitants per square mile.
